Best Crypto Tax Software 2026: Koinly vs CoinTracker vs TokenTax
Compare the top 5 crypto tax software platforms: pricing ($49-$3,499), exchange support, DeFi tracking, NFT capabilities, and TurboTax integration to find the best fit for your portfolio.
Top 5 Crypto Tax Software Platforms
The best crypto tax software combines automated exchange integrations, comprehensive DeFi support, accurate tax calculations, and easy TurboTax exports. The five leading platforms in 2026 are Koinly, CoinTracker, TokenTax, CoinLedger, and ZenLedger. Each excels in different areas—beginners should prioritize ease-of-use, active traders should prioritize DeFi support, and CPA firms should prioritize accuracy and customization.
Crypto tax compliance is a mess, but ignoring it is worse. We focus on practical approaches that balance accuracy with the reality that most exchanges have incomplete records.
Koinly: Best for DeFi Tracking
Koinly is the most popular crypto tax software, known for exceptional DeFi tracking and automated wallet integration. The platform connects to 500+ exchanges and DeFi protocols, automatically syncing transactions via API. Koinly supports Uniswap, Aave, Curve, staking, liquidity pools, and governance token airdrops—capturing complex DeFi activity that other platforms miss.
Pricing & Plans
Koinly offers a free tier for up to 100 transactions. Starter ($99/year) supports 1,000 transactions. Trader ($199/year) handles 10,000 transactions. Professional ($279/year) for 100,000+ transactions. All paid tiers include tax document exports (Form 8949, Schedule D, tax summary) compatible with TurboTax. For most active crypto users, the Trader plan ($199) suffices.
DeFi Support & Automation
Koinly excels at DeFi tracking. Connect your wallet via MetaMask, and Koinly automatically detects all on-chain DeFi transactions: swaps, liquidity pool deposits/withdrawals, staking, lending. The software accounts for impermanent loss (LP position losses), auto-compounds rewards, and tracks governance tokens. For Uniswap V3 or complex AMM positions, Koinly's accuracy is industry-leading.
CoinTracker: Best for Beginners
CoinTracker prioritizes user experience and simplicity. The platform features an intuitive dashboard, clear tax reporting, and fast customer support. CoinTracker connects to 600+ exchanges and has solid integration with Coinbase, Kraken, Gemini, and Binance. For users without complex DeFi positions, CoinTracker rivals Koinly in accuracy with better onboarding.
Pricing & Customer Support
CoinTracker Basic: $59/year for simple tracking. Premium: $199/year with full tax reporting. Both tiers include TurboTax-compatible exports. CoinTracker has responsive customer support (live chat, email) and active community forums. For users struggling with tax software, CoinTracker's support team significantly reduces setup friction.
Tax Report Quality
CoinTracker generates IRS-compliant tax reports with a visual dashboard showing tax liability estimates. The "TurboTax Direct" export feature automatically fills your TurboTax return. For casual investors holding Bitcoin and Ethereum on spot exchanges, CoinTracker's reports are comprehensive and audit-ready.
TokenTax: Best for Accuracy
TokenTax is preferred by professional traders, CPAs, and cryptocurrency accountants for unmatched accuracy and customization. The platform handles complex scenarios (wash sales, trading lot selection, margin trading) with granular control. While less automated than Koinly, TokenTax's manual customization ensures accuracy for high-stakes tax filings.
Pricing Structure
TokenTax pricing varies by portfolio size: $65 (basic crypto), $199 (advanced), $499 (professional), $999 (enterprise), up to $3,499 (custom). The pricing model incentivizes larger transactions/portfolios. For a portfolio with $50K+ in annual trading volume, expect the $199+ tier. Enterprise customers (exchanges, mining operations) pay $3,499 annually for white-label reporting.
Customization & Professional Features
TokenTax allows manual lot selection (specific ID method for capital gains optimization), multi-currency accounting, and adjustments for wash sales, airdrops, and hard forks. The software generates professional CPA reports suitable for client delivery. For CPAs or high-income professionals needing defensible tax positions, TokenTax's documentation is IRS audit-proof.
CoinLedger: Best for Simplicity
CoinLedger balances simplicity with comprehensive features. The platform is positioned between beginner-friendly CoinTracker and professional TokenTax. CoinLedger supports 300+ exchanges, generates clean tax reports, and integrates with accounting software. The UX is more straightforward than TokenTax without sacrificing features.
Pricing & Tiers
CoinLedger: $49 (starter), $149 (professional), $299 (premium). Starter covers basic tax reporting. Professional adds DeFi support and advanced reporting. Premium is best for active traders and small exchanges. All tiers export to TurboTax-compatible formats. The $49 starter tier offers good value for simple portfolios.
Exchange Support & Integration
CoinLedger supports major exchanges (Coinbase, Kraken, Binance, FTX legacy) plus some DeFi protocols. For users with straightforward exchange-based portfolios, the integration is seamless. The platform is less powerful than Koinly for DeFi but simpler than TokenTax.
ZenLedger: Best Value
ZenLedger offers competitive pricing and solid feature coverage. The platform connects to 300+ exchanges and provides clean tax reporting at lower price points than Koinly or TokenTax. For budget-conscious users needing basic crypto tax software, ZenLedger is compelling. The UX is adequate (not exceptional), but the cost-per-feature ratio is excellent.
Pricing & Plans
ZenLedger: $49 (basic), $149 (professional), $399 (premium). Basic covers 100 transactions. Professional is unlimited transactions plus DeFi support. Premium adds advanced reporting and multi-user access. ZenLedger occasionally offers discounts, making effective pricing lower than listed rates.
Strengths & Limitations
ZenLedger's strength is affordability; limitations include less comprehensive DeFi support than Koinly and less customization than TokenTax. For straightforward crypto portfolios, ZenLedger is sufficient. For complex positions or audit concerns, upgrade to Koinly or TokenTax.
DeFi Tax Tracking Comparison
DeFi tax tracking is where crypto tax software diverges most significantly. Koinly and TokenTax support 50+ DeFi protocols; CoinTracker and CoinLedger have limited DeFi support. For users with liquidity pools, yield farming, or staking, DeFi tracking capability is essential. An inaccurate DeFi transaction can inflate reported gains by $10K+.
Supported DeFi Protocols
Koinly supports Uniswap (v2 and v3), Aave, Curve, Compound, MakerDAO, Lido staking, Yearn vaults, and 50+ additional protocols. TokenTax covers Uniswap, Aave, curve, and major protocols via CSV uploads. CoinTracker and CoinLedger have partial support for major protocols but miss niche platforms. For exotic DeFi (Balancer, Bancor, obscure yield farms), Koinly is the only reliable option.
Liquidity Pool Tracking
Koinly automatically detects LP deposits, withdrawals, and impermanent loss. The software tracks cost basis for each LP share and calculates gains/losses at withdrawal. TokenTax requires manual uploads but allows customization. CoinTracker and CoinLedger miss many LP scenarios entirely. For Uniswap V3 concentrated positions, only Koinly tracks the complex mechanics accurately.
Staking Income Tracking
All platforms track basic staking (Ethereum 2.0, Solana). Koinly\'s strength is auto-compounding detection—if staking rewards are auto-restaked, Koinly correctly tracks the cost basis of reinvested rewards. Manual staking income entry works across all platforms.
NFT Support Across Platforms
NFT tax treatment remains unclear, creating software limitations. Koinly and TokenTax have emerging NFT support (detecting sales, calculating gains); CoinTracker and CoinLedger have minimal NFT tracking. Most platforms struggle with NFT valuation (determining fair market value for tax purposes) since blockchain data alone doesn\'t indicate price.
NFT Sale Tracking
Koinly can track NFT sales on OpenSea, Rarible, and other marketplaces via wallet connection. The software detects the sale price and calculates gains. However, it cannot automatically determine your cost basis—you must manually enter what you paid originally. TokenTax offers similar functionality with more manual controls.
NFT Cost Basis Challenges
Most NFTs are purchased via ETH, so cost basis requires converting ETH price on purchase date. Software cannot automatically do this for all NFTs, requiring manual entry. Recommendation: maintain a separate NFT tracking spreadsheet (purchase date, ETH paid, ETH price, USD cost basis) and manually enter into software.
Crypto Tax Software Comparison Table
| Software | Price Range | DeFi Support | Exchanges | TurboTax Export | Free Tier |
|---|---|---|---|---|---|
| Koinly | $49-$279/year | Excellent (50+ protocols) | 500+ (API auto-sync) | Yes (Form 8949) | 100 transactions |
| CoinTracker | $59-$199/year | Good (major protocols) | 600+ (API) | Yes (Direct export) | Limited basic |
| TokenTax | $65-$3,499/year | Excellent (CSV upload) | 400+ (mixed) | Yes (Form 8949) | None |
| CoinLedger | $49-$299/year | Fair (basic protocols) | 300+ (API) | Yes (csv export) | Basic demo |
| ZenLedger | $49-$399/year | Fair (limited protocols) | 300+ (API) | Yes (Form 8949) | Limited demo |
Frequently Asked Questions
Which crypto tax software is best for DeFi and yield farming?
Koinly and TokenTax have the most comprehensive DeFi support. Koinly offers automated wallet sync for 50+ protocols including Uniswap, Aave, Curve, and Lido. TokenTax requires CSV uploads but provides more customization. For complex yield farming, Koinly is fastest; for maximum accuracy, TokenTax is best.
Does crypto tax software integrate with TurboTax or professional tax software?
All major platforms (Koinly, CoinTracker, TokenTax, CoinLedger, ZenLedger) export to TurboTax-compatible formats (CSV, Form 8949, Schedule D). CoinTracker has direct TurboTax integration. Most professional tax preparers prefer manual import of generated reports for greater control.
What is the price difference between Koinly, CoinTracker, and TokenTax?
Koinly: $99-$279/year. CoinTracker: $59-$199/year. TokenTax: $65-$3,499/year depending on portfolio size. For basic portfolios, CoinTracker offers best value. For complex DeFi, Koinly\'s mid-tier ($199) is competitive. For professional accuracy, TokenTax\'s $199+ is worth the cost.
How many exchanges can crypto tax software connect to?
CoinTracker supports 600+ exchanges/platforms. Koinly supports 500+. TokenTax supports 400+. CoinLedger and ZenLedger support 300+. Most major exchanges (Coinbase, Kraken, Binance) are supported by all. The difference matters for niche exchanges—Koinly and CoinTracker cover more.
Do crypto tax software platforms track NFTs and gaming tokens?
Koinly and TokenTax have NFT tracking. CoinTracker has emerging NFT support. CoinLedger and ZenLedger have limited NFT features. For NFT-heavy portfolios, Koinly is most mature. NFT tax rules remain unclear, so manual cost basis tracking is recommended alongside software.
What is included in the free tier of crypto tax software?
Koinly\'s free tier covers 100 transactions (no tax report export). CoinTracker has limited free tracking. TokenTax and ZenLedger have no free tier. Most free tiers don\'t generate tax reports—you must pay for exports. Budget $50-$300 for tax filing.